Class ConfigurationData
- java.lang.Object
-
- de.hybris.platform.sap.productconfig.facades.ConfigurationData
-
- All Implemented Interfaces:
java.io.Serializable
public class ConfigurationData extends java.lang.Object implements java.io.Serializable
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description ConfigurationData()
-
Method Summary
All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description java.lang.String
getCartItemPK()
Deprecated, for removal: This API element is subject to removal in a future version.Rather use property linkedToCartItemjava.lang.String
getConfigId()
CPQActionType
getCpqAction()
java.util.List<UiGroupData>
getCsticGroupsFlat()
java.lang.String
getFocusId()
java.lang.String
getGroupIdToDisplay()
java.lang.String
getGroupIdToToggle()
java.lang.String
getGroupIdToToggleInSpecTree()
java.util.List<UiGroupData>
getGroups()
UiGroupForDisplayData
getGroupToDisplay()
java.lang.String
getKbBuildNumber()
KBKeyData
getKbKey()
java.util.List<ProductConfigMessageData>
getMessages()
java.lang.String
getPrevNextButtonClicked()
PricingData
getPricing()
long
getQuantity()
java.lang.String
getSelectedGroup()
int
getStartLevel()
boolean
isAnalyticsEnabled()
boolean
isAsyncPricingMode()
boolean
isAutoExpand()
boolean
isComplete()
boolean
isConsistent()
boolean
isForceExpand()
boolean
isHideImageGallery()
boolean
isInputMerged()
boolean
isLinkedToCartItem()
boolean
isPriceSummaryCollapsed()
boolean
isPricingError()
boolean
isShowLegend()
boolean
isShowVariants()
boolean
isSingleLevel()
boolean
isSpecificationTreeCollapsed()
void
setAnalyticsEnabled(boolean analyticsEnabled)
void
setAsyncPricingMode(boolean asyncPricingMode)
void
setAutoExpand(boolean autoExpand)
void
setCartItemPK(java.lang.String cartItemPK)
Deprecated, for removal: This API element is subject to removal in a future version.Rather use property linkedToCartItemvoid
setComplete(boolean complete)
void
setConfigId(java.lang.String configId)
void
setConsistent(boolean consistent)
void
setCpqAction(CPQActionType cpqAction)
void
setCsticGroupsFlat(java.util.List<UiGroupData> csticGroupsFlat)
void
setFocusId(java.lang.String focusId)
void
setForceExpand(boolean forceExpand)
void
setGroupIdToDisplay(java.lang.String groupIdToDisplay)
void
setGroupIdToToggle(java.lang.String groupIdToToggle)
void
setGroupIdToToggleInSpecTree(java.lang.String groupIdToToggleInSpecTree)
void
setGroups(java.util.List<UiGroupData> groups)
void
setGroupToDisplay(UiGroupForDisplayData groupToDisplay)
void
setHideImageGallery(boolean hideImageGallery)
void
setInputMerged(boolean inputMerged)
void
setKbBuildNumber(java.lang.String kbBuildNumber)
void
setKbKey(KBKeyData kbKey)
void
setLinkedToCartItem(boolean linkedToCartItem)
void
setMessages(java.util.List<ProductConfigMessageData> messages)
void
setPrevNextButtonClicked(java.lang.String prevNextButtonClicked)
void
setPriceSummaryCollapsed(boolean priceSummaryCollapsed)
void
setPricing(PricingData pricing)
void
setPricingError(boolean pricingError)
void
setQuantity(long quantity)
void
setSelectedGroup(java.lang.String selectedGroup)
void
setShowLegend(boolean showLegend)
void
setShowVariants(boolean showVariants)
void
setSingleLevel(boolean singleLevel)
void
setSpecificationTreeCollapsed(boolean specificationTreeCollapsed)
void
setStartLevel(int startLevel)
-
-
-
Method Detail
-
setKbKey
public void setKbKey(KBKeyData kbKey)
-
getKbKey
public KBKeyData getKbKey()
-
setKbBuildNumber
public void setKbBuildNumber(java.lang.String kbBuildNumber)
-
getKbBuildNumber
public java.lang.String getKbBuildNumber()
-
setPricing
public void setPricing(PricingData pricing)
-
getPricing
public PricingData getPricing()
-
setGroups
public void setGroups(java.util.List<UiGroupData> groups)
-
getGroups
public java.util.List<UiGroupData> getGroups()
-
setCsticGroupsFlat
public void setCsticGroupsFlat(java.util.List<UiGroupData> csticGroupsFlat)
-
getCsticGroupsFlat
public java.util.List<UiGroupData> getCsticGroupsFlat()
-
setConfigId
public void setConfigId(java.lang.String configId)
-
getConfigId
public java.lang.String getConfigId()
-
setLinkedToCartItem
public void setLinkedToCartItem(boolean linkedToCartItem)
-
isLinkedToCartItem
public boolean isLinkedToCartItem()
-
setSelectedGroup
public void setSelectedGroup(java.lang.String selectedGroup)
-
getSelectedGroup
public java.lang.String getSelectedGroup()
-
setShowLegend
public void setShowLegend(boolean showLegend)
-
isShowLegend
public boolean isShowLegend()
-
setAutoExpand
public void setAutoExpand(boolean autoExpand)
-
isAutoExpand
public boolean isAutoExpand()
-
setStartLevel
public void setStartLevel(int startLevel)
-
getStartLevel
public int getStartLevel()
-
setQuantity
public void setQuantity(long quantity)
-
getQuantity
public long getQuantity()
-
setFocusId
public void setFocusId(java.lang.String focusId)
-
getFocusId
public java.lang.String getFocusId()
-
setSpecificationTreeCollapsed
public void setSpecificationTreeCollapsed(boolean specificationTreeCollapsed)
-
isSpecificationTreeCollapsed
public boolean isSpecificationTreeCollapsed()
-
setPriceSummaryCollapsed
public void setPriceSummaryCollapsed(boolean priceSummaryCollapsed)
-
isPriceSummaryCollapsed
public boolean isPriceSummaryCollapsed()
-
setInputMerged
public void setInputMerged(boolean inputMerged)
-
isInputMerged
public boolean isInputMerged()
-
setGroupIdToDisplay
public void setGroupIdToDisplay(java.lang.String groupIdToDisplay)
-
getGroupIdToDisplay
public java.lang.String getGroupIdToDisplay()
-
setGroupToDisplay
public void setGroupToDisplay(UiGroupForDisplayData groupToDisplay)
-
getGroupToDisplay
public UiGroupForDisplayData getGroupToDisplay()
-
setGroupIdToToggle
public void setGroupIdToToggle(java.lang.String groupIdToToggle)
-
getGroupIdToToggle
public java.lang.String getGroupIdToToggle()
-
setGroupIdToToggleInSpecTree
public void setGroupIdToToggleInSpecTree(java.lang.String groupIdToToggleInSpecTree)
-
getGroupIdToToggleInSpecTree
public java.lang.String getGroupIdToToggleInSpecTree()
-
setForceExpand
public void setForceExpand(boolean forceExpand)
-
isForceExpand
public boolean isForceExpand()
-
setConsistent
public void setConsistent(boolean consistent)
-
isConsistent
public boolean isConsistent()
-
setComplete
public void setComplete(boolean complete)
-
isComplete
public boolean isComplete()
-
setHideImageGallery
public void setHideImageGallery(boolean hideImageGallery)
-
isHideImageGallery
public boolean isHideImageGallery()
-
setSingleLevel
public void setSingleLevel(boolean singleLevel)
-
isSingleLevel
public boolean isSingleLevel()
-
setShowVariants
public void setShowVariants(boolean showVariants)
-
isShowVariants
public boolean isShowVariants()
-
setPrevNextButtonClicked
public void setPrevNextButtonClicked(java.lang.String prevNextButtonClicked)
-
getPrevNextButtonClicked
public java.lang.String getPrevNextButtonClicked()
-
setCpqAction
public void setCpqAction(CPQActionType cpqAction)
-
getCpqAction
public CPQActionType getCpqAction()
-
setMessages
public void setMessages(java.util.List<ProductConfigMessageData> messages)
-
getMessages
public java.util.List<ProductConfigMessageData> getMessages()
-
setAsyncPricingMode
public void setAsyncPricingMode(boolean asyncPricingMode)
-
isAsyncPricingMode
public boolean isAsyncPricingMode()
-
setPricingError
public void setPricingError(boolean pricingError)
-
isPricingError
public boolean isPricingError()
-
setAnalyticsEnabled
public void setAnalyticsEnabled(boolean analyticsEnabled)
-
isAnalyticsEnabled
public boolean isAnalyticsEnabled()
-
setCartItemPK
@Deprecated(since="1808", forRemoval=true) public void setCartItemPK(java.lang.String cartItemPK)
Deprecated, for removal: This API element is subject to removal in a future version.Rather use property linkedToCartItem
-
getCartItemPK
@Deprecated(since="1808", forRemoval=true) public java.lang.String getCartItemPK()
Deprecated, for removal: This API element is subject to removal in a future version.Rather use property linkedToCartItem
-
-